BG07 XSB is a 2007 Citroen Grand C4 Picasso in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 54.5%.
Across all 2007 Citroen Grand C4 Picasso models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.9% with a typical mileage of 71,338 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Grand C4 Picasso f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 4,114 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BG07 XSB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Grand C4 Picasso typ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 19 years old, this Citroen Grand C4 Picasso is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
